Dewx vs Gusto FAQ
Is Dewx a good alternative to Gusto?
For client-facing operations, yes. Gusto is the clear winner for payroll processing, benefits administration, and HR compliance. But if your primary challenge is managing client relationships, outreach, and communications, Dewx provides tools Gusto simply does not — unified inbox, CRM, AI automation, and outreach sequences.
Can Dewx replace Gusto for payroll?
No. Dewx does not process payroll, handle tax filings, or administer employee benefits. Gusto is purpose-built for these tasks. If payroll is your core need, Gusto is the right tool.
What does Dewx have that Gusto does not?
Dewx offers a unified inbox combining WhatsApp, LinkedIn, Gmail, Instagram, and Outlook, a built-in CRM with pipeline management, AI assistant that executes business tasks, multi-channel outreach sequences, and comprehensive project management — none of which Gusto provides.
What does Gusto have that Dewx does not?
Gusto has automated payroll with direct deposit and tax filings, full benefits administration including health insurance and 401k, contractor payment management, workers compensation insurance, and HR compliance tools. These are core Gusto strengths Dewx does not replicate.
How does Gusto pricing compare to Dewx?
Gusto starts at approximately $40/month plus $6 per person per month, so costs scale with team size. Dewx uses flat-rate subscription pricing for CRM, inbox, AI, and operations regardless of team size.
